Vice President Of Finance

City Harvest, Inc. is seeking a Vice President of Finance to join our team. The Vice President of Finance will serve as a transformational leader responsible for modernizing the organization's financial infrastructure, business processes, and reporting capabilities. This role will lead enterprise-wide finance transformation initiatives, including ERP implementation and optimization, while fostering a culture of continuous improvement, innovation, and data-driven decision-making.

Analyze and propose solutions based on knowledge of professional principles and best practices. The VP of Finance will also manage and/or perform highly technical or complex work, requiring ingenuity and capacity to evaluate and respond to new and changing issues.

The primary purpose of this role includes:

  • Directing all accounting and finance functions for the organization, including payroll, accounts payable, budget and financial reporting. This includes but not limited to oversight of daily cash management and administration of City Harvest's credit card program in compliance with established policies and procedures.
  • Driving the modernization of finance processes, systems, and controls through automation, standardization, and adoption of best practices. Partners with key stakeholders to identify opportunities to leverage technology to improve operational efficiency, data integrity, reporting capabilities, and user experience.
  • Evaluating, formulating, recommending and implementing sound fiscal policies, procedures and controls, including oversight of internal control compliance and related financial and internal control systems.
  • Appraising the organization's financial position, providing in-depth financial analysis and assessment of organizational results and provides recommendations.
  • Preparing quarterly Board reporting (Statement of Financial Position, Statement of Activities, Statement of Cash Flows) and interim reports for Senior Management.
  • Partnering effectively with outside auditors for tax preparation and audit, including the audit of the 403(b) plan and preparation of organizational filings (including Form 990, Form 990T, Form W-2, Form 1099).
  • Leading, mentoring and developing the accounting and finance teams (three direct reports and seven indirect reports).
  • Leading organizational change management efforts related to new financial systems, including stakeholder engagement.

Position requirements include:

Education:

Bachelor's degree, plus additional related courses, training or relative experience

Experience:

Seven to ten years related experience; program or operational management experience and supervisory experience. Experienced in managing and mentoring the accounting team, providing guidance on financial procedures, professional development, and day-to-day operations. Foster a culture of accountability and continuous improvement within the department.

Related skills or knowledge:
Must have knowledge of not-for-profit accounting. CPA is required. Knowledge of MS Office and various accounting software packages is essential. Strong written and verbal communication, ability to speak across departments. Experience redesigning business processes and implementing leading finance practices. Strong change management and cross-functional leadership skills.
